ACTION: Notice of Availability of Solicitation Number DE-PS07- 99ID13831--Steel Industries of the Future. ----------------------------------------------------------------------- SUMMARY: The U.S. Department of Energy (DOE), Idaho Operations Office, is seeking applications for cost-shared research and development of technologies which will reduce energy consumption, enhance economic competitiveness, and reduce environmental impacts of the steel industry. The research is to address research priorities identified by the steel industry in the Steel Industry Technology Roadmap. S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The statutory authority for this program is the Federal Non-Nuclear Energy Research & Development Act of 1974 (Pub. L. 93-577). Approximately $5,000,000 to $6,000,000 in federal funds is expected to be available to fund the first year of selected research efforts. DOE anticipates making one to three cooperative agreement awards each with a duration of five years or less. Collaborations between industry, university, and National Laboratory participants are encouraged. The issuance date of Solicitation No. DE-PS07-99ID13831 is on or about September 15, 1999.
